    About the event

    We enter relationships hoping to be each other's support and companions on life's journey. Unfortunately, many couples, after the initial period of infatuation and love, gradually get stuck in an unfavorable pattern of mutual behaviors that weaken the sense of trust, safety, and cooperation. As a result, the couple experiences less emotional and physical closeness, and it becomes increasingly difficult for partners to enjoy a relationship that once provided shelter, excitement, and hope for a good future. This happens because you have been swept up in a whirlpool of misunderstandings, unspoken words, silence, or frustration. Our workshop is an opportunity to break free from this exhausting pattern. We offer you an experience during which you can learn how to jointly strengthen your sense of cooperation, mutual understanding, and safety, allowing you to fully enjoy your relationship and creatively use the differences between you. Our workshop is based on the knowledge and methods of the highly effective couples therapy model: EFT (Emotionally Focused Therapy for Couples). It was developed and expanded by Dr. Sue Johnson, who is also the author of our workshop scenario, based on her book "Hold Me Tight." During the workshop—with the support of the facilitators—you will experience seven conversations that will help you better understand each other, take care of your sense of safety, and inspire you to cooperate for joy and comfort in your relationship. During the meeting, you will learn why you get caught in unfavorable patterns. Most importantly, we will present you with seven conversations that address key areas of your romantic relationship. Each conversation will be presented, discussed, and you will be able to have it in a safe atmosphere and with the support of the facilitators. This will allow you to experience the transformative power of each of these dialogues. As a result, you will gain knowledge and tools on how to break the deadlock in difficult moments and work together for your relationship, which can be a source of support, satisfaction, and happiness. Our workshop is for you if: - you feel you don't understand each other, and communication used to be easier, - it's hard for you to spend time together, you feel lonely, - you feel overwhelmed and lack freedom, - one of you doesn't feel important to the other, - you want to get to know yourselves and each other better, - you can't end a dispute in a meaningful way, - you are losing your emotional bond, - there is criticism and exhausting conflicts between you, - you lack intimacy and emotional and physical closeness, - you have stopped appreciating what each of you brings to the relationship, - difficult topics keep coming up in your conversations. CONTRAINDICATIONS Our workshop is NOT intended for couples in which: - one partner has decided to break up, - there is emotional or physical violence, - one person is simultaneously involved in a relationship with someone else, - one or both people are experiencing serious mental health problems, - there has been a recent affair, - one or both people are struggling with active, severe addiction. The workshops help to understand the universal difficulties that arise in relationships. Therefore, we address them, also in the materials, to all couples, regardless of the gender of the people involved. A few words about the facilitator, Barbara Sławik – certified psychotherapist and EFT supervisor Certified psychotherapist of the Polish Psychological Association and the European Association for Psychotherapy, she completed postgraduate studies in Psychodynamic Psychotherapy and Couples and Family Therapy at the Psychoeducation Laboratory, a center recommended by the Polish Psychological Association and the Polish Psychiatric Association. She also completed basic and advanced training in Mentalization Based Treatment, accredited by the Anna Freud Center in London. Since 2017, she has been involved in the development of Emotionally Focused Therapy in Poland. She is the first ICEEFT-certified EFT therapist and supervisor in Poland. Since 2019, she has been conducting EFT training for the Polish psychotherapist community, and since 2021, also supervision and seminars. She collaborates with the Silva Rerum Integrative Psychotherapy School in Warsaw, where she teaches on the course for Psychotherapy Supervisors. For several years, she worked at the Institute of Psychiatry and Neurology in Warsaw. A few words about the facilitator, Łukasz Niszkiewicz – EFT therapist after full training Certified psychotherapist of the Polish Psychiatric Association, he completed a comprehensive psychotherapy course at the Greater Poland Systemic Therapy Association in Poznań, and is also an addiction psychotherapy specialist. Psychologist, graduate of Adam Mickiewicz University in Poznań. He works under constant supervision in several parallel supervisory processes. He completed full training in EFT for couples and is in the process of certification. He has participated in many trainings developing his psychotherapeutic skills (including narrative couples therapy and coherence therapy). In individual therapy for adults, he integrates systemic, psychodynamic, and coherence therapy approaches. In working with couples, he uses the EFT approach. As an addiction psychotherapy specialist, he worked for 20 years in an addiction treatment clinic. He currently works in private practice, a mental health clinic, and a stationary hospice in Ostrów Wielkopolski.
